Thailand’s premier rock band Slot Machine are lighting up Asia this year with back-to-back festival appearances. On 5 July, they’ll bring their explosive live energy to Skechers Sundown Festival in Singapore. Then on 26 September, they’ll hit the stage at Busan International Rock Festival in South Korea, joining The Smashing Pumpkins and Babymetal for one of the region’s biggest rock lineups this year.

“We’re excited to be back in places we love,” the band shared. “Whether our audience has been with us for years or just discovered us, that connection means everything.”

The band recently sparked regional buzz with a musical swap that saw them rework Indonesian act Coldiac’s‘Beautiful Day’ into a soaring rock anthem, while Coldiac returned the favour with a chilled take on Slot Machine’s ‘Skyline’. The crossover has drawn over 3.9 million views on Instagram and has fans calling for a full-on collaboration or live performance.

This momentum is fueling Slot Machine’s rising international profile. Their 2024 single ‘Walk the Earth’, executive-produced by Ryan Tedder, hit 10 million views and won Best International Song of the Year at The Guitar Magazine Awards 2025. They also closed Bangkok Music City Festival earlier this year before dropping another Tedder-produced track, ‘Skyline’.
